If I use Launcher Pro +, do I need to uninstall it to try this? Can I save my settings to go back if I don't like adw ex?

Sent from my DROIDX using Tapatalk

Download "Home Switcher" from the marketplace and then get ADW EX. That will allow you to switch between the two for testing. Be aware, you only have 15 minutes to try it out... yes we know, it's BS. Besides, it's only $3. Now, if you get ADW EX and you use it permanently, it would be best to uninstall LP+ to save room, or if you don't want to do that and you're rooted, use Titanium Backup to freeze LP+ without removing it.
